  • Patent number: 11926521
    Abstract: An infrared emitter with a glass lid for emitting infrared radiation comprises a package enclosing a cavity, wherein a first part is transparent for infrared radiation and a second part comprises a glass material and a heating structure configured for emitting the infrared radiation, wherein the heating structure is arranged in the cavity between the first part and the second part of the package.

  • Patent number: 8579532
    Abstract: A dosing device with a monolithic, resilient roll meters liquid detergent, softener, concentrates, cleaning agents, and other medium-viscosity liquids. The rolling application element is used for applying detergent to very dirty fabric areas. The monolithic roll (3) encompassing a shaft (5) and an outer jacket (6) with plastic recesses is inserted into a mount (1) of a dosing receptacle (2). Radially extending spring lamellae are molded between the shaft (5) and the outer jacket (6).
